Tuscaloosa, Alabama: University of Alabama Press, 1990. Hardcover. Fine/Fine. A 253 page work with an index, a bibliography and a glossary. Volume itself has greenish gray covers with sharp orange lettering on the spine. The upper outer corner of the front cover is lightly dented. Interior pages are clean, fresh, tight and bright. Dust jacket is protected in an archival quality cover. A very nice, conservatively graded copy; available for immediate shipment, carefully packed in a sturdy box.
